Transaction 718e9bb5b626cccad6d68f84094926116f77f7b4fc44abbceb4d099c7778ed62

2 Input
2 Outputs
  • 718e9bb5b626cccad6d68f84094926116f77f7b4fc44abbceb4d099c7778ed62:0
  • value  352296
    address  3MbA9t5eh24LNJsnsPvx6iDmiMDPmPB1Pk
  • 718e9bb5b626cccad6d68f84094926116f77f7b4fc44abbceb4d099c7778ed62:1
  • value  1697908
    address  3BMA3atAnp5Rc6zmBpirdRCAvgjmc6tkyV